Stol (2236 m)

Highlight • Summit

Stol, imenovan tudi Veliki Stol, je najvišji vrh Karavank. V bližini glavnega vrha je na njegovi južni strani Mali Stol (2198 m). Med obema vrhovoma je sedlo Med Stoli. Stol se proti vzhodu veže prek grebenov Belščice ali Orlice (Celovška špica, 2105 m) in Svačice (1953 m) s skalnato gmoto Vrtače. Proti zahodu se Stolovo sleme nadaljuje prek Potoškega Stala (2014 m) in Belščice (Vajnež, 2104 m) do sedla Seča ali Medvedjak (1698 m), ki ga loči od Struške, njo že prištevamo k skupini Golice. Na severu padajo mogočne razdrapane stene v zatrep Medvedjega dola na Koroškem. Južna pobočja Stola so razbrazdana z dolgimi žlebovi in nad širokim pasom planin na višini okoli 1200 m zelo strma, pod planinami proti dolini Završnice pa položnejša. Stol je tudi osrednja gora Stolove gorske skupine med Ljubeljem in Medvedjakom. Sestavljen je iz triasnih apnencev in dolomitov. Na njegovih travnatih vesinah, meliščih in skalnih policah raste značilna alpska flora: planika, murka, Zoisova vijolica, lepi jeglič, navadni alpski zvonček, retijski in julijskoalpski mak, brezstebelna lepnica in še mnoge druge.

Razgled s Stola je izredno širok. Na vzhodu so v bližini Belščica, Vrtača, Begunjščica in Košuta. Proti jugovzhodu vidimo Dobrčo, Kamniške Alpe, Posavsko hribovje s Kumom in Gorjance. Obširna je tudi južna stran: pod nami je gorenjska ravnina s Kranjem, Radovljico, Bledom in drugimi kraji, naprej Ljubljanska kotlina z Ljubljano, potem pa notranjsko hribovje do Snežnika, Polhograjsko in Škofjeloško hribovje, Trnovski gozd, Porezen, Ratitovec in Jelovica. Prelep je pogled proti jugozahodu na Julijce s Triglavom ter na Pokljuko in Mežaklo v ospredju ter na Dolomite na obzorju. Na zahodu lepo vidimo greben Karavank s Potoškim Stolom, Belščico in Kepo, ob južnem vznožju grebena pa del Zgornje Savske doline z Jesenicami in Mojstrano. Lep razgled je tudi proti severu na Rož, dolino Drave ter Čelovško kotlino s Čelavcem in Vrbskim jezerom, proti severovzhodu do Obirja, Pece in Svinške planine, proti severozahodu pa do Nizkih in Visokih Tur.

Stol ima velik pomen tudi za slovensko planinsko organizacijo; na njem se je rodila ideja o ustanovitvi Slovenskega planinskega društva. Mladi hribolazci Josip Hauptman, Ivan Korenčan in Anton Škof so se 23. julija 1892 povzpeli na Stol. Ob lepem vremenu so se pogovarjali, zakaj so po vseh slovenskih gorah samo nemške koče, nemški napisi in kažipoti. »Vzdramimo se!« so rekli mladeniči, si podali roke in se pobratili ter sklenili, da ne bodo odnehali, dokler se ne ustanovi slovensko planinsko društvo. Prevzeli so pobudo in želja se jim je kmalu uresničila: 27. februarja 1893 je bila v Ljubljani ustanovljeno Slovensko planinsko društvo.

Veliki Vrh Summit

Highlight • Summit

Begunjščica is a mountain range in the Karavanke Mountains east of Stol. Begunjščica rises above the Draga valley north of Begunje. The steep southern slopes are up to about 1500 m wooded, in the upper part ruined and grassy. The eastern rocky edge of the mountain rises above the narrow Šentanska valley, which separates Begunjščica from Košuta. The western wooded slope below Roblekov dom descends steeply into the narrow valley of Završnica. The northern slopes from Smokuška planina to Ljubelj are rocky and precipice, and in between there are extensive screes and gutters. From the peak ridge of the mountain rise three peaks: the eastern is Begunjska Vrtača (1991 m), the middle Veliki vrh (2060 m) is the highest peak of the mountain, and the western is Srednji vrh (1979 m). The mountain is composed of Triassic limestones. Begunjščica is known for its rich flora; here also grow the long-flowered primrose, the horned violet, the beautiful shoe, the fragrant wolfberry, the pink viper, the wig-headed, the yellow heather, and the other plants. Chamois and ibex can also be seen on the rocks and on the grass shelves. Due to easy access, Begunjščica is visited throughout the year. In addition, in winter and spring, with favorable snow conditions, its screes are a ready terrain for touring skiing.

From the top there is a very nice view. In the north, below the precipice walls, there is the Zelenica valley and above it the ridges of Ljubeljščica, Na Možeh, Palca and Vrtače, and on the horizon we can see Visoke Ture with good visibility. To the east is a wide view of the Košuta, Kamnik and Savinja Alps and Peca. In the south, at the foot of the valley, is the Draga valley, to the east of it rises Dobrča, and to the west the Stol mountain range; the Gorenjska plain expands further, followed by the Škofja Loka hills, Ratitovec, Jelovica, Pokljuka and Julijci.

Prešeren Lodge at Stol (2174 m)

Highlight • Mountain Hut

The hut stands on the sunny side just below the top of Mali Stol (2198 m). The first hut was built in 1909 by the Kranj branch of the SPD, and was ceremoniously opened on July 31, 1910. It was named after the greatest Slovenian poet, dr. France Prešeren (1800-1849), a host from Vrba pod Stolom. In 1927, the hut was enlarged, and the opening was on July 15, 1928. After the famous battle of Stol, on February 20, 1942, the partisans burned the hut so that the Germans would not have a base in it. At the initiative of the surviving fighters of the Battle of Stol, PD Javornik-Koroška Bela built a new mountain lodge on the foundations of the old hut and opened it on 21 August 1966. In 1981-1984 the hut was significantly enlarged and renovated, and the grand opening was on 4 August 1984. The hut is open from mid - June to mid - September.

Views:

Prešeren's hut stands on an extremely scenic spot. On the east side we see Vrtača, Begunjščica and Košuta; to the southeast, the view stops at the Kamnik Alps, Menina planina, the Posavje hills with Kum and Gorjanci; the whole south side is very varied, when the view walks along the Ljubljana basin and the wide Gorenjska plain, the Notranjska hills to Snežnik, across the Škofja Loka mountain range to Trnovski gozd, Porezno, Ratitovec and Jelovica, we see Kranj, Radovljica and Lake Bled, and with good visibility Ljubljana; there is a beautiful view to the southwest of Julijce with Triglav and Pokljuka and Mežakla in the foreground, if the atmosphere is clean, we can see the Dolomites in the background; we can see the Karavanke ridge, which stretches from Stol to the west with Belščica in the foreground and Kepa in the background; the view to the north obscures the nearby southern slope of Veliki Stol. From the top of Stol there is a wide view to the north of the steep slopes of the Karavanke towards the Drava valley, to the Klagenfurt basin with Klagenfurt, to the east to Obir, Peca and Svinška planina, and to the northwest to Nizke and Visoke Tur.

The Hochstuhl (obsolete Stou, Slovenian Stol) is a mountain on the border between Carinthia (Austria) and Slovenia. With a height of 2237 m, it is the highest peak in the Karawanks. Its sharp northern cliffs form an impressive valley head in the Carinthian Bärental.

Are there any peaks with significant historical importance in the Žirovnica area?

Yes, Ajdna is a distinctive peak with significant historical value. It served as an archaeological site from Late Antiquity, where locals sought refuge from invaders during the 5th and 6th centuries. The mysterious atmosphere of its ancient past adds a unique dimension to the challenging hike.

Can I find mountain huts for refreshment or overnight stays near the peaks?

Absolutely. The Valvasorjev dom pod Stolom is a highly regarded mountain hut, known for its hospitality and homemade food, making it an excellent base or stopover for hikes to Stol. The Prešeren Lodge at Stol (2174 m) and Kleinstuhl and Preschern Hut are also available, with the latter offering beautiful views of the upper Savetal.
